We invite you to join the special international webinar inspired by the new book Prevention Gone Wrong: The Do’s, Don’ts, and the Common-Sense Lessons in Drug Prevention for Children and Youth by Matej Košir, hosted by UTRIP, WFAD, and Drug Free America Foundation.
